Lavender house is a stunning bespoke property of a contemporary style, constructed by a highly regarded local developer, in this popular and sought-after village. The property enjoys a superb location, tucked away behind Church Street and benefits from stunning views across open farmland to the rear. It is accessed via a private gated drive, which is shared with just one other property of a similar design and layout.

The property will benefit from an exceptionally high specification with a 'Nicholas Anthony' kitchen with integral appliances. Heating will be provided by an air source heat pump supplemented by PV panels, with underfloor heating throughout the ground floor, and radiators on the first floor.

The design is such hat it is well-suited to modern lifestyles, and is being constructed with the latest modern technology to ensure it is well-equipped and suitable for a sustainable and environmentally friendly future.

There is a large double garage with electric roller door, plant room and plumbing, above which is a spacious home office or studio with full height window, ideal for the ever-increasing requirements to be able to work from home. In addition, superfast fibre broad band is available in the village. There is extensive paved and gravelled parking to the front of the property, which will be landscaped in accordance with the plans.

The rear garden is of a substantial size, and benefits from a westerly aspect, enabling the occupants to take advantage of the afternoon and evening sun. There are already a number of mature and attractive native specimen trees, along with a pretty native mixed hedge to the rear boundary.

The plot measures approximately 0.65 of an acre (stls).
